Output 51e86b5dd4eebc12106f1b1b4b182c36c6fd1bcb5fe7c646491237e61f3a85ed:1

value
2132114
script pubkey
OP_0 OP_PUSHBYTES_20 96001953b63d0e555c31b79c8bb403c98f3e99c8
address
tb1qjcqpj5ak85892hp3k7wghdqrex8naxwgll228x
transaction
51e86b5dd4eebc12106f1b1b4b182c36c6fd1bcb5fe7c646491237e61f3a85ed